<FORM METHOD=POST ACTION="" NAME="form1">
<INPUT TYPE="submit" onclick="action='1.php';target='_blank'">
<INPUT TYPE="submit" value=fsdaf onclick="action='2.php';target='_self'">
</FORM>

解决方案 »

  1.   

    是不是要这样
    if (id=='1')
    {
    document.form1.action='1.php';
    document.form1.target='_blank';
    }
    if (id=='2')
    {
    document.form1.action='2.php';
    }
      

  2.   

    类似代码:
    function  funDo(strURL){
       switch (strURL){
        case "view":
        frm_s_cntrt.action="../cntrt/cntrt_view.asp";
        frm_s_cntrt.target="b_main"
        break;
    case "update":
    frm_s_cntrt.action="../cntrt/cntrt_update.asp";
        frm_s_cntrt.target="b_main"
    break;
    case "stop":
    frm_s_cntrt.action="../cntrt/cntrt_stop_add.asp";
    frm_s_cntrt.target="b_main"
    break;
    case "charge":
    frm_s_cntrt.action="../cntrt/money.asp";
    frm_s_cntrt.target="b_main"
    break;
    case "change":
    frm_s_cntrt.action="../chargeRpt/charge_cntrt_list.asp";
    frm_s_cntrt.target="b_main"
    break;
    case "del":
    frm_s_cntrt.action="../cntrt/cntrt_recv.asp";
    frm_s_cntrt.target="b_main"
    frm_s_cntrt.cntrt_do.value="del"
    var msg = "您真的确定要作废该合同吗?\n\n请确认!";
    if (confirm(msg)==true){
    // return true;
    }else{
    return false;
    }
    break;
    case "print":
    frm_s_cntrt.action="../receipt/cntrt_revert.asp";
    frm_s_cntrt.target="view"
    frm_s_cntrt.cntrt_do.value="revert"
    break;
    default :
        frm_s_cntrt.action="../cntrt/cntrt_list.asp";
       }
       frm_s_cntrt.submit();
       return false;
        }